CafePress Exceeds EPS Consensus Results for the First Quarter 2012

Company Corrects News Services’ Erroneous Reporting Regarding Consensus Estimates

LOUISVILLE, Ky., May 8, 2012 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— CafePress Inc. (Nasdaq:PRSS), The World’s Customization EngineTM, noted that its first quarter EPS results were above analysts’ expectations for the period.

CafePress reported a GAAP net loss per basic and diluted share of ($0.06), compared to analysts’ consensus of a loss of ($0.09) per share. After CafePress reported its first quarter results, several news services reported consensus EPS results and guidance that were incorrect. A table reiterating the correct information is below.

About CafePress (PRSS):

CafePress is The World’s Customization EngineTM. Launched in 1999, CafePress empowers individuals, groups, businesses and organizations to create, buy and sell customized and personalized products online using the company’s innovative and proprietary print-on-demand services and e-commerce platform. Today, CafePress’ portfolio of e-commerce websites include CafePress.com, CanvasOnDemand.com, GreatBigCanvas.com, Imagekind.com, InvitationBox.com, and LogoSportswear.com.
